Failed findings

  • toxic items stored near food
    Official wording: No Evidence Of Rodent Or Insect Outer Openings Protected/Rodent Proofed, A Written Log Shall Be Maintained Available To The Inspectors
    Inspector note: All necessary control measures shall be used to effectively minimize or eliminate the presence of rodents, roaches, and other vermin and insects on the premises of all food establishments, in food-transporting vehicles, and in vending machines. NOTED ABOUT 20-SMALL/FRUIT FLIES ON UPPER WALL & CEILING AT THE LEFT-HAND SIDE OF BAR AREA; 15-ON WALL BY REAR DOOR TO A HALLWAY; 6-HOVERING ON THE SINK DRAIN A(LEFT SIDE OF 3-COMP BAR SINK). MUST ELIMINATE SOURCE, SANITIZE AFFECTED AREAS & CONTACT P.C.O.
    code 18
  • food prep surfaces dirty
    Official wording: Food And Non-Food Contact Equipment Utensils Clean, Free Of Abrasive Detergents
    Inspector note: All food and non-food contact surfaces of equipment and all food storage utensils shall be thoroughly cleaned and sanitized daily. FOLLOWING NEED CLEANING: CAN OPENER, INTERIOR OF HANDSINK & DRAINS AT 3-COMP SINK IN BAR; INTERIOR OF GARBAGE BIN AT BAR; FAN GUARDS OF WALK-IN COOLERS-DUE TO DUST/FOOD DEBRIS OR STAINS/SPILLS.
    code 33
  • Floors: Constructed Per Code, Cleaned, Good Repair, Coving Installed, Dust-Less Cleaning Methods Used
    Inspector note: The floors shall be constructed per code, be smooth and easily cleaned, and be kept clean and in good repair. FLOORS ALONG WALLBASES UNDER SINKS IN BAR AREA & IN DISHROOM MUST BE FREE OF DEBRIS/FOOD STAINS.
    code 34
  • Walls, Ceilings, Attached Equipment Constructed Per Code: Good Repair, Surfaces Clean And Dust-Less Cleaning Methods
    Inspector note: The walls and ceilings shall be in good repair and easily cleaned. MUST SANITIZE ANY WALL SECTION WITH FOOD STAINS/SPLASHES OF BEVERAGES AT BAR, UNDER DISHMACHINE,OR PREP AREAS. MUST SEAL OPENINGS AROUND PIPES OR SODA LINES ON WALL OR CEILING-TO PREVENT PEST ENTRY.
    code 35
